Leveller Posted February 11, 2023 Report Share Posted February 11, 2023 37 minutes ago, Percy Pig said: It is clearly a tactical ploy. And it makes sense generally, too. The design is to ensure that when we cannot play out from the back because the opposition press has been good we have a higher percentage chance of retaining possession by chipping it into the fullbacks. Thats because we either win the header or the opposition defender wins it and likely heads it out for a throw. Execution was slightly off today, but its a very small margin for error with that kick. Max has been brilliant since coming in. He's kept a cleansheet against one of the best forwards to ever play this level, he's dominated his box and he's getting better at knowing when the pressure needs to be averted by going longer. If he whacked it down the middle we'd lose the ball and be right back under pressure. If he plays short when it's not on, pelters. He's been TOLD to do this, and its obvious why. Those were my thoughts too. It happened so often it had to be deliberate. If you kick up the centre of the pitch and we lose possession (which we frequently do) the risk is higher than conceding a throw in near the halfway line. And if it lands just inside the line, the full backs have a good chance of getting on the end of it. If the opposition win the header, it’s still less dangerous than in the centre circle.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
